When traveling to Xinjiang, whether to choose a group tour or go alone depends mainly on one’s travel preferences, schedule, and budget. Overall, if you pursue freedom and personalized experiences, have ample time, and are willing to make travel plans, going alone (self-guided tour) may be better; if you hope to save effort, have limited time or a sensitive budget, joining a group (package tour) may be a more suitable choice.?
Advantages of self-guided tours:?
Freedom of time: You can arrange your itinerary as desired, wake up whenever you want, and stay wherever you want for as long as you want.?
Freedom of route: Choose where to go based entirely on your own interests, without being limited by the group’s itinerary.?
Freedom of spending: Greater choice in shopping and dining, allowing for spending as desired.?
Disadvantages of self-guided tours:?
Inconvenient transportation: Xinjiang has a vast territory, and self-driving can lead to fatigue, requiring detailed travel plans and route planning.?
Higher costs: If budget control is not well managed, the cost of a self-guided tour may be higher than a package tour, especially when encountering unfamiliar places where one can easily be taken advantage of.?
Potential safety hazards: Without insurance coverage, you are responsible for any issues that arise.?
Advantages of package tours:?
Effortless and worry-free: The travel agency is responsible for arranging everything, including transportation, accommodation, dining, and sightseeing, without the need for personal concern.?
High safety: Travel agencies have professional tour guides and teams that can promptly resolve issues with lower risks.?
Lower costs: Since travel agencies have partnerships with attractions, hotels, etc., they can obtain discounted prices, so the cost of package tours may be lower.?
Disadvantages of package tours:?
Fixed itinerary: The route and itinerary are arranged by the travel agency, limiting personal freedom.?
Limited exploration time: You need to follow the group’s itinerary, which may prevent you from deeply exploring places of interest to you.?
There may be unreliable risks: If you choose an unreliable travel agency or group, you may encounter issues such as poor service quality or additional fees.?
